Gameplay Best positions to play for every level of player from beginner to intermediate to advanced position breakdown

8 Upvotes

Feel free to disagree but this is just form my experience here is the best position to play for every

level of player form beginner to advanced highly competitive ranked players. Think of this as a cheat sheet.

For Beginners the Shooting Guard- SG or the 2.

You are the star of the show and the SG is the easiest position for a new player to learn.

You get to score the most amount of points and that is your main responsibility

but you are also a secondary point guard and you need to be a two way player.

Once you get the hang of the game, you can set inverted screens for your wings and bigs.

For intermediate players

The big men the Power Forward-PF-4 or the Center-C-5

There is not much that separates these two because sometimes as the PF you get matched up

with the Center. Your primary responsibilities are

1- Box out and grab the rebounds.

2-Both positions are the defensive anchors of the team

3- When you grab a rebound, if you are open, slam dunk it in or hit the middy,

4-Set screens for your guards and wings.

5- Space the floor.

if not then pass it to the guard.

For advanced players the Small Forward-SF 3

This is the most athletic player in the game and your responsibilities are huge.

You are the definition of Mr. two way player and you are a triple double machine.

Your job is to guard the 3 and sometimes play help defense,

You have to be able to play switch defense, guard the perimeter and the interior and

stop the rim rockers.

If you are a two way Point Forward like me, your also a secondary assist man and ball handler.

You have to have a high basketball IQ and skills to be an efficient 2 way Point Forward.

The Point Guard the 1 the PG.

You are the floor General or the Quarterback of your team.

Your responsibilities are huge, like the SF, it is an advanced position but the upside is also big.

The offense flows through you, and you dictate the tempo and pace of the game.

A good point guard plays defense and is a pass first, shoot second player.

A good point guard can also set inverted screens for other players

This position is best left for people with high skill and high basketball IQ
